So, in an effort to find some activity to occupy our day, I finally got my husband to take us somewhere that I have wanted to go to FOREVER.... Brookgreen Gardens. I have driven past this place for years, and it looked so beautiful, but that was nothing compared to the beauty that was found inside.

The property is HUGE. I'm not sure just exactly how many acres this place covers, but you could spend an entire day, or more, exploring everything they have to offer. We visited the zoo there, an indoor butterfly pavilion, immaculate gardens with beautiful flowers, fountains, sculptures and quaint paths. I haven't been that relaxed in a long time. And it was such a good, family time! If you ever visit near Murrell's Inlet, SC, it is worth your time to pay this beautiful place a visit.
